(MENAFN- The Arabian Post) clearfix"> Onix is pushing a specialised model of artificial intelligence that gives individual experts control over AI systems trained on their own work, betting that trust, privacy and domain knowledge can offer an alternative to general-purpose chatbots.

The Montreal-based company, co-founded by David Bennahum and Nicholas Nadeau, has concentrated initially on health and wellness, where users can interact with AI versions of recognised specialists whose knowledge bases are built from licensed research, publications, frameworks and other material supplied with their consent.

Rather than training one broad model to answer questions across countless subjects, Onix creates separate systems centred on individual experts. The company describes the approach as“Personal Intelligence”, arguing that AI designed around a clearly identified authority can deliver guidance closer to that person's expertise, language and professional boundaries.
